  degree_requiremnts_add_info: |-
    Thesis and Non-Thesis Pathways
    Students can customize their degree by applying for an optional thesis. Those who are accepted for the thesis track will collaborate with a faculty mentor developing pharmaceutical advancements. Non-thesis students will seek opportunities to participate in summer internships at some of the most prestigious p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ies in the Boston area.

  pgrad_prog_desc: |-
    As a pharmaceutical scientist, you play an important role in discovering and developing new medications that impact lives. In this program, you’ll build on your previous bachelor’s degree in pharmacy, chemistry or biology to explore dosage forms and the release of a drug from the dosage form, and pharmacokinetics, the study of the process by which a drug is absorbed, distributed, metabolized and eliminated by the body.

    During this graduate program, you’ll have the opportunity to work alongside professional experts in modern laboratories to gain a firm understanding of the materials and technologies associated with pharmaceutical product development, manufacture, and evaluation. You’ll graduate ready to participate in research to formulate new medications or continue your education with a PhD in Pharmaceutics.
